A client has reported all of the following; which should be given priority by the nurse?
1. Pain
2. Hunger
3. Anxiety
4. Constipation
ANS: 1
When a client has diverse priority needs, it helps to focus on the client's basic needs; pain will exacerbate the client's anxiety and interfere with eating and thus should be attended to first. While a concern, constipation is the lowest priority problem.
